A 19-year-old man is in hospital in critical condition after a horrific crash sent him and his car hurtling into a highway overpass in Ohio.

Video taken by a dashboard camera shows the car, a Pontiac Firebird, speeding past a police cruiser on Interstate 675 and suddenly veering left, then hitting a culvert.

The car is launched in the air before smashing into the concrete pillar of an overpass. Police said the victim was ejected in the crash and the car "disintegrated" into pieces.

No one else was injured in the accident and no other vehicle was involved.

Police said the car was going as fast as 160 km/h at the time of the crash.

"He is very lucky to still be alive at this point," Ohio State Highway Patrol Lieutenant Marty Fellure is reported to have said at the scene.

Police say the cause of the crash is still under investigation.
